Nigeria Mini Football Boosts Leadership With Appointment of Mulade, Clarkson

The Nigeria National Mini Football Association (NIMFA) has announced the appointment of Ambassador Sheriff Mulade and Comrade Clarkson Ogo into key national leadership positions.

According to appointment letters jointly signed by NIMFA President, Alhaji Datti Umar Yusuf, and Secretary General, Paul Maduakor, Sheriff Mulade has been named National Deputy President, while Clarkson Ogo will serve as Deputy Secretary of the federation.

The newly appointed officials received their letters at the Africa For Peace Games Village (APGV), where they expressed gratitude to the national body for the confidence reposed in them. Both officials pledged renewed commitment toward the growth and development of mini football in Nigeria.

Speaking on the appointments, NIMFA President Alhaji Datti Umar Yusuf described both individuals as dedicated and passionate administrators.

“Both the Delta State Chairman, Sheriff, and Secretary, Clarkson, are very committed to promoting this fast-rising sport in Nigeria,” Datti Umar said. “The Delta State Mini Football Association executives are truly championing the affairs of mini football in Nigeria, and we need them in the main affairs.”

Before his elevation, Sheriff Mulade served as National Coordinator of the Center for Peace and Environmental Justice (CEPEJ) and is currently the Chairman of the Delta State Mini Football Association.

Meanwhile, Clarkson Ogo, who also serves as Secretary of the Delta State Mini Football Association, is a renowned sports journalist and the Chief Executive Officer of Topsportsafrik, an international sports media organization.

Their appointments are expected to further strengthen NIMFA’s leadership structure as the federation continues to expand the reach of mini football across the country.
